While a player's methods and calculations might be tried and true,
what happens a lot with WGT is that the avatar's position varies in relation to the hole.
Most desired is the straight on (perpendicular) angle like the letter 'T', but what happens is some shot avatar placements are skewed more left and down or to the right etc.
This makes the info from the dots different then when if the avatar is centered, as mentioned by many WGT pros.
They quote things like "the dots are moving...but it's a straight putt" or "the dots don't move but the ball will roll to the right" (due to the skewed angle of the avatar).
I believe this is sometimes the reason why people aim & hit toward the wrong area.
